Gurbax Singh Sandhu honoured with 2017 National Awards for senior citizens.

Indian boxing coach Gurbax Singh Sandhu has been honoured with the 2017 National Awards for senior citizens by President Ramnath Kovind. Sandhu was India’s longest-serving men’s national coach, occupying the position for two decades before he was handed charge of the women campers earlier in 2017. He was the chief coach when India won its maiden Olympic medal in boxing through Vijender Singh in 2008.
